20th Annual Wellness Fair Gift Basket

February 6, 2012 by Kerry Sauriol 4 Comments

I have mentioned the upcoming 20th Annual Wellness show that starts February 17th at the Vancouver Convention Centre over on WetCoastWomen.  For an idea of just how huge and varied the show is, click here.   I am most keen on the Living Well and Women and Wellness Tracks.

As a wife and mother I tend to put myself last on the ladder of well being…..physically and mentally.  It took me a month to get antibiotics for a MONTH long cough.  I am not a martyr…..it is just that I tend to be more focused on those I love and can forget the ‘self love’ and how important that is too.

I am looking forward to the workshops and chatting with the many exhibitors….I hope to be inspired and find solutions that will lead me to feeling more satisfied with life and moving forward in a more positive manner.  If you can’t find that at a wellness show, where can you?  Our much loved entrepreneurial and personal coach, Heather White is speaking on the Friday on this very topic.
